Beef Roast

- 3-4 pounds beef roast chuck or ribeye
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 cloves garlic minced
- 1 tablespoon salt
- 1 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 tablespoon dried thyme
- 1 tablespoon rosemary
- 2 cups beef broth
- 4 carrots chopped
- 4 potatoes diced
- 1 large onion quartered
Preheat your oven to 325°F (165°C).
Season the beef roast with salt, black pepper, thyme, and rosemary.
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
Sear the beef roast on all sides until browned (about 3-4 minutes per side).
Remove the roast and place it in a roasting pan.
Add garlic, carrots, potatoes, and onion to the pan around the roast.
Pour beef broth over the vegetables and roast.
Cover the pan with aluminum foil or a lid.
Roast in the preheated oven for 2-3 hours or until the meat reaches your desired doneness.
Let the roast rest for 15 minutes before slicing and serving.
